Kenneth Cole Unpaid Internship Class Action Settlement
Class Eligibility
You are considered a class member if you were an unpaid intern for Kenneth Cole Productions, Inc. or Kenneth Cole Consumer Direct, LLC , at any time during the period from December 2, 2008 to July 31, 2017.

Case Name
In re: Kenneth Cole Productions Inc. Intern Settlement, Case No. 161886/2014, Supreme Court of the State of New York, New York County
Case Summary
A lawsuit was filed by a former unpaid intern alleging that Defendants violated the New York Labor Law by failing to pay interns minimum wages. The current plaintiff in the action, Oluseyi Awogbile (“Named Plaintiff”), for himself and others whom he claims are similarly situated, seeks to recover allegedly unpaid minimum wages as well as interest, attorneys’ fees, costs, and other relief.
Defendants deny that they violated the law or that they owe any interns wages. Defendants deny any liability and maintain that they have consistently acted in accordance with all governing laws at all times. To avoid the burden, expense, inconvenience, and uncertainty of continued litigation, however, Defendants have concluded that it is in their best interests to resolve and settle the lawsuit, without admitting any wrongdoing or liability, and by entering into a settlement agreement (“Agreement”).
The lawsuit is presently before Justice Joan Kenney of the Supreme Court of the State of New York, County of New York. Judge Kenney has not made any decision on the merits of Plaintiffs’ claims in the lawsuit or whether the case, in the absence of this settlement, may proceed as a class and/or collective action.
